File Upload Demo (C#)

<%@ Page language="c#" src="WebForm1.aspx.cs" AutoEventWireup="false" Inherits="UploadFile.WebForm1" %>
<HTML>
  <body>
    <form id="Form1" enctype="multipart/form-data" method="post" runat="server">
      <INPUT id="FileInput" style="Z-INDEX: 101; LEFT: 32px; WIDTH: 552px; POSITION: absolute; TOP: 24px; HEIGHT: 24px" type="file" size="72" name="File1" runat="server">
      <asp:button id="cmdUpload" style="Z-INDEX: 102; LEFT: 32px; POSITION: absolute; TOP: 72px" runat="server" Text="Upload"></asp:button>
      <asp:Label id="lblInfo" style="Z-INDEX: 103; LEFT: 32px; POSITION: absolute; TOP: 128px" runat="server" Width="608px" Height="72px" Font-Names="Verdana" Font-Size="Medium" Font-Bold="True"></asp:Label></form>
  </body>
</HTML>


<%--
using System;
using System.Collections;
using System.ComponentModel;
using System.Data;
using System.Drawing;
using System.Web;
using System.Web.SessionState;
using System.Web.UI;
using System.Web.UI.WebControls;
using System.Web.UI.HtmlControls;
using System.IO;

namespace UploadFile
{
  /// <summary>
  /// Summary description for WebForm1.
  /// </summary>
  public class WebForm1 : System.Web.UI.Page
  {
    protected System.Web.UI.WebControls.Button cmdUpload;
    protected System.Web.UI.WebControls.Label lblInfo;
    protected System.Web.UI.HtmlControls.HtmlInputFile FileInput;
  
    private void Page_Load(object sender, System.EventArgs e)
    {
      // Only accept image types.
      FileInput.Accept = "image/*";
    }

    #region Web Form Designer generated code
    override protected void OnInit(EventArgs e)
    {
      //
      // CODEGEN: This call is required by the ASP.NET Web Form Designer.
      //
      InitializeComponent();
      base.OnInit(e);
    }
    
    /// <summary>
    /// Required method for Designer support - do not modify
    /// the contents of this method with the code editor.
    /// </summary>
    private void InitializeComponent()
    {    
      this.cmdUpload.Click += new System.EventHandler(this.cmdUpload_Click);
      this.Load += new System.EventHandler(this.Page_Load);

    }
    #endregion

    private void cmdUpload_Click(object sender, System.EventArgs e)
    {
            if (FileInput.PostedFile.FileName == "")
            {
                lblInfo.Text = "No file specified.";
            }
            else
            {
                try
                {
                    string serverFileName = Path.GetFileName(FileInput.PostedFile.FileName);
                    //FileInput.PostedFile.SaveAs(@"c:\" + serverFileName);
                    FileInput.PostedFile.SaveAs(MapPath("."+ serverFileName);
                    lblInfo.Text = "File " + serverFileName;
                    lblInfo.Text += " uploaded successfully.";
                }
                catch (Exception err)
                {
                    lblInfo.Text = err.Message;
                }
            }

    }
  }
}

--%>
